SAT rejects fresh access to Sathe’s frozen funds
Financial Express Pune
|February 19, 2026
INTHE LATEST blowtoAvadhut Sathe Trading Academy, the Securities Appellate Tribunal (SAT) on Monday dismissed its plea to continue withdrawing funds from frozen bank accounts to meet monthly expenses.
The Tribunal observed that the academy and its directors had failed to complywith its earlier directive to file an affidavit disclosing their assets, adding that a judicial pronouncement cannot be modified once delivered.“Admittedly, the appeal has been finally disposed of by this Tribunal. Therefore, no further orders are necessary to give effect to this Tribunal’s order,’ the SAT stated.
